Now here’s the photo we used yesterday – it was one of my Mom’s………………..
This is the beautiful “Luray Singing Tower” – a carillion tower with 47 bells that was built in the town of Luray, Virginia by the Luray Caverns, in 1937. Here’s a link to more information if you’d like to learn something about it. Mom and Dad have heard the bells and they are BEAUTIFUL!!!! CLICK HERE
